Spaceflight (or space flight) is an application of astronautics to fly objects, usually spacecraft, into or through outer space, either with or without humans on board. Most spaceflight is uncrewed and conducted mainly with spacecraft such as satellites in orbit around Earth, but also includes space probes for flights beyond Earth orbit. Such spaceflights operate either by telerobotic or autonomous control. The first spaceflights began in the 1950s with the launches of the Soviet Sputnik satellites and American Explorer and Vanguard missions. Human spaceflight programs include the Soyuz, Shenzhou, the past Apollo Moon landing and the Space Shuttle programs. The V-2 (German: Vergeltungswaffe 2, "Vengeance Weapon 2"), technical name Aggregat-4 (A4), was the world's first long-range ballistic missile. It was developed during the Second World War in Germany, specifically targeted at London and later Antwerp.

Commonly referred to as the V-2 rocket , the liquid-propellant rocket was a combat-ballistic missile, now considered short-range, and first known human artifact to enter outer space. It was the progenitor of all modern rockets, including those used by the United States and Soviet Union's space programs. During the aftermath of World War II the American, Soviet and British governments all gained access to the V-2's technical designs as well as the actual German scientists responsible for creating the rockets, via Operation Paperclip, Operation Osoaviakhim and Operation Backfire respectively.

The weapon was presented by Nazi propaganda as a retaliation for the bombers that attacked ever more German cities from 1942 until Germany surrendered.

Beginning in September 1944, over 3,000 V-2s were launched as military rockets by the German Wehrmacht against Allied targets during the war, mostly London and later Antwerp and Liège. According to a BBC documentary in 2011, the attacks resulted in the deaths of an estimated 9,000 civilians and military personnel, while 12,000 forced labourers and concentration camp prisoners were killed producing the weapons.

Christopher Columbus Kraft, Jr. (born February 28, 1924 in Phoebus, Virginia, died July 07, 2019 in Houston, Texas) was a NASA engineer and manager who was instrumental in establishing the agency's Mission Control operation. Following his graduation from Virginia Tech in 1944, Kraft was hired by the National Advisory Committee for Aeronautics (NACA), the predecessor organization to the National Aeronautics and Space Administration (NASA). He worked for over a decade in aeronautical research before being asked in 1958 to join the Space Task Group, a small team entrusted with the responsibility of putting America's first man in space. Assigned to the flight operations division, Kraft became NASA's first flight director. He was on duty during such historic missions as America's first human spaceflight, first human orbital flight, and first spacewalk.

At the beginning of the Apollo program, Kraft retired as a flight director to concentrate on management and mission planning. In 1972, he became director of the Manned Spacecraft Center (later Johnson Space Center), following in the footsteps of his mentor Robert R. Gilruth. He held the position until his 1982 retirement from NASA. During his retirement, Kraft has consulted for numerous companies including IBM and Rockwell International, and he published an autobiography entitled Flight: My Life in Mission Control.

More than any other person, Kraft was responsible for shaping the organization and culture of NASA's Mission Control. As his protégé Glynn Lunney commented, "the Control Center today ... is a reflection of Chris Kraft." When Kraft received the National Space Trophy from the Rotary Club in 1999, the organization described him as "a driving force in the U.S. human space flight program from its beginnings to the Space Shuttle era, a man whose accomplishments have become legendary."

...that the Vehicle Assembly Building is so large that rain clouds are reported to form inside it on humid days?
